Reactions of Mini (dw) Broiler Parents to Energy Intake at the Beginning of the Incubation Period

Abstract

In this researche, Ross PM3(dw) broiler parent groups were fed for five weeks from 5% of production so as to consume totally 12447, 11950, 11400 and 10922 kcal ME; and then fed by 130 g/ bird/day (340 kcal/kg) of normal breeder feed. Production perfonmances at the end of 33 weeks of age and hatching results at 28 and 32 weeks were examined. In conclusion, the treatment effects on egg production, feed conversion for hatching eggs, body weight and mortality were not statistically significant. Whereas, the effect of age x trement interaction fertility and hatchability, and effect of age onon fertility were found statistically significant. Fertility rised up by age. Second treatment group was determined as the best with respect to hatching results. Begining at 5% of production, increasing daily ME consumption per hen from 300 kcal to 370 kcal whitin five weeks gradually and decreasing to 340 kcal begining after 2 weeks sould have given good rusults. Treatment and interaction effects on early, mid term and late embryo deaths were not significant. The effect of age on early and late embryo deaths was statistically significant. While the age goes up from 28 to 32 weeks, the early deaths decreased and the late deaths increased significantly. Any significant effect was not found about internal piping of the embryo.
